Luka Dončić footed the entire bill to rehabilitate a graffitied tribute of Kobe and Gigi Bryant, affectionately named “Mambas Forever,” situated in downtown Los Angeles. This artwork portrays the late Lakers star in his signature jersey, tenderly clutching Gianna, his beloved daughter, close to him.

On Monday, the Instagram account @kobemural posted videos of the damage and pointed fans towards a GoFundMe initiative launched by Louie “Sloe” Motion, the creator of the mural. By Tuesday, the fundraising target was achieved, largely due to a $5,000 donation from the Los Angeles Lakers guard.

In 2018, two years prior to Luka Dončić’s NBA debut, Kobe Bryant had already retired. However, they shared an emotional courtside encounter in 2019 when Bryant astonished Dončić by conversing with him in Slovenian. Although the conversation was brief, it left a profound impact on Dončić and fans alike.
Dončić stated, “Kobe belongs to L.A.” He and Gigi hold immense significance for this city, the Lakers team, and me individually. I’m eager to contribute in any way possible to ensure they and his daughter receive due recognition.
